The work will be challenging, but always rewarding. **It's Work That Matters.** **Overview** **Purpose Statement/Position Summary:** The Research Post Doc Fellow, is in training to help develop the academic knowledge and research fundamentals, teaching expertise and administrative experience necessary to be an exemplary researcher. Perform laboratory work and conduct research activities independently or in collaboration with the Principal Investigator. Publish results in scientific manuscripts and research publications. Participate in seminars, meetings, trainings and other educational sessions. Ideally we would prefer applicants with the following skills: Mouse handling and intra-cranial survival surgery, Bulk or single cell RNA sequencing experience (tissue collection, library prep, bioinformatics), Studying mouse behavior using chemogenetics, FACS sorting from mouse brain, and In vivo fiber photometry. **Minimum Qualifications/Work Experience:** Exposure to and/or experience in research in a healthcare environment preferred. **Education/Licensure/Certification:** MD and/or PhD, or equivalent doctoral degree. Applicants must have completed their doctoral degree by their anticipated start date. **Pay Scale Information** $29,640.00-$80,196.00 CHLA values the contribution each Team Member brings to our organization.
